If you have a dynamic external IP on that box its a bit difficult, but if another box is doing the NATing its easy:

in httpd.conf (asuming your local Ip is 192.168.1.1) NameVirtualHost 192.168.1.2

ServerName bugadventures.dyndns.org DocumentRoot bugpicturesdir

ServerName jeepadventures.dyndns.org DocumentRoot jeeppictures

done...

*cough* Eduardo misspelled the .1.1 and 1.2 there. They should be all the same.

yes... local IP is asumed to be 192.168.1.2 :)
